About The Position

As an Airside Experience Specialist, you are the face of our private aviation terminal, delivering a seamless, personalized, and welcoming experience for every guest, crew member, and aircraft in our care. In this dynamic role, you'll combine exceptional hospitality with hands-on operational support to ensure our guests feel cared for, from wheels down to wheels up. You'll operate ground service equipment and perform aircraft ground services while engaging guests with professionalism and a service-first mindset. This role requires schedule flexibility, including nights, weekends and holidays, and the ability to thrive in outdoor environments around active aircraft and in varying weather conditions. Requirements

  • High School Diploma or General Education Degree (GED).
  • Minimum of 18 years of age.
  • Ability to pass company background checks (criminal and motor vehicle) and drug tests.
  • Meet airport background check requirements to receive and maintain an airport security badge.
  • Must be legally authorized to work in the jurisdiction of employment.
  • Excellent vision and coordination to move and/or direct aircraft and visually inspect aircraft fuel.
  • Ability to pass a color vision test for inspecting aviation fuel.
  • Must possess a valid state driver's license.
  • In some locations, a commercial driver's license (CDL) is required.
  • Ability to exercise good judgment and follow directions from supervisor/management.

Responsibilities

  • Deliver a seamless, personalized, and welcoming experience for guests, crew members, and aircraft.
  • Operate ground service equipment and perform aircraft ground services.
  • Engage guests with professionalism and a service-first mindset.
  • Work flexible hours including nights, weekends, and holidays.
  • Thrive in outdoor environments around active aircraft and in varying weather conditions.
  • Provide professional and friendly guest service.
  • Load and unload luggage and other cargo into/out of aircraft.
  • Maintain safe, clean, and secure ramps and operations.
  • Fuel handling, including fuel quality control and maintaining accurate documentation.
  • Report safety concerns and follow emergency response procedures.
  • Create accurate records pertaining to time worked and activities performed.
